توضیحات
Polylang یک افزونه فوق العاده برای چند زبانه کردن وردپرس است. پسوند Polylang به شما امکان می دهد زبان مورد نظر را بر اساس کشور تشخیص دهید.
اگر وبسایت شما دارای 2 زبان مختلف با یک زبان است (مانند de_DE برای آلمانی/آلمانی و de_AT برای آلمانی/اتریش)، آنگاه Polylang بهطور خودکار زبان را با توجه به تنظیمات مرورگر تنظیم میکند.
بازدیدکنندگان وب سایت اتریشی که سیستم عامل / مرورگر خود را روی آلمان تنظیم کرده اند (به عنوان مثال دستگاه ها در آلمان خریداری شده اند) همیشه به de_DE هدایت می شوند.÷
این افزونه زبان مورد نظر را بر اساس کشور بازدیدکننده تشخیص میدهد و زبان صحیح را روی de_AT تنظیم میکند.
Please notice that the IP API is only for non-commercial use allowed.
پلاگین مورد نیاز
- Polylang Pro توسط WP SYNTEX – Polylang به شما امکان می دهد یک سایت وردپرس دو زبانه یا چند زبانه ایجاد کنید.
نصب
- افزونه Polylang مورد نیاز را که در https://polylang.pro موجود است نصب کنید
- ‘pll-country-detection’ را در فهرست ‘/wp-content/plugins/’ آپلود کنید یا افزونه را مستقیماً از طریق صفحه افزونه های وردپرس نصب کنید.
- افزونه را از طریق صفحه “افزونه ها” در وردپرس فعال کنید.
- گزینه «تشخیص زبان مرورگر» را در «زبانها > تنظیمات» فعال کنید
سوالات متداول
-
تشخیص کشور چگونه کار می کند؟
-
این افزونه کشور را با IP Geolocation API (https://ip-api.com/) شناسایی می کند.
اگر زبان موجود بر اساس کشور یافت نشد، زبان مرورگر ترجیح داده می شود. (https://polylang.pro/doc/detect-the-browser-preferred-language/) -
من یک اشکال پیدا کردم، چه کار کنم؟
-
اگر اشکالی در افزونه من پیدا کردید، لطفاً یک ایمیل با توضیح کوتاه برای من ارسال کنید.
در اسرع وقت مشکل را برطرف خواهم کرد. -
شما افزونه من را دوست دارید و می خواهید از من حمایت کنید؟
-
بسیار از شما متشکرم!
اگر می خواهید نشان دهید که چقدر از کار من قدردانی می کنید، بسیار سپاسگزار خواهم بود اگر بتوانید با وردپرس-صفحه به من امتیاز مثبت بدهید و/یا مبلغ کمی را به من اهدا کنید.
نقد و بررسیها
توسعه دهندگان و همکاران
“Polylang – Country Detection” نرم افزار متن باز است. افراد زیر در این افزونه مشارکت کردهاند.
مشارکت کنندگان“Polylang – Country Detection” به 3 زبان ترجمه شده است. با تشکر از مترجمین برای همکاری و کمکهایشان.
ترجمه “Polylang – Country Detection” به زبان شما.
علاقه مند به توسعه هستید؟
Browse the code, check out the SVN repository, or subscribe to the development log by RSS.
گزارش تغییرات
1.3.1
- Fix – Check if the class Polylang_Country_Detection already exists
1.3.0
- Feature – Anonymize the IP addresses from the client
- Dev – Changed the geolocation API from ip-api.com to iplocate.io
- Dev – Check compatibility with latest Polylang and WordPress Version
1.2.1
- Fix – Filter all non active languages
1.2.0
- قابلیت ترجمه اضافه شد
1.1.0
- رفع – مشکل بازگشت متغیر زبان
1.0.0
- انتشار اولیه
- سازگاری با آخرین نسخه Polylang و وردپرس را بررسی کنید